Noise Level < 28dB Effective Range 300–600 ft² / 27–55 m² Dimensions 8.4 x 10.0 x 28.7 in / 21.4 x 25.3 x 72.8 cm Weight6.4 lb / 2.9 kg Note: To access additional smart humidifier functions, download the free VeSync app (see page 11). 3 SAFETY INFORMATION • Only use the humidifier as described in this manual. • Place the humidifier and cord so that it will not be knocked over. Do not place near large pieces of furniture or in high-traffic areas. • When not in use, turn the humidifier off and disconnect from power by removing the plug from the outlet. • Do not use the humidifier in wet environments. • Keep the humidifier out of reach from children. • Do not open the base or remove the water level sensor for self-servicing. • Always unplug your humidifier from the power outlet before cleaning your humidifier or detaching the humidifier base from the water tank. • Always make sure to place the humidifier on a flat, level surface before operation. • Only fill the water tank with clean water. Never fill the water tank with any other liquids. • Do not place the humidifier near sources of heat, such as stovetops, ovens, or radiators. • Do not use other items as replacement parts for this product. To reduce the risk of fire, electric shock, or other injury, follow all instructions and safety guidelines. General Safety • Do not cover the nozzle while the humidifier is on. Doing so may damage the humidifier. • Do not immerse the humidifier base, power cord, or plug in water. • If the humidifier is damaged or is not functioning properly, stop using it and contact Customer Support immediately (see page 27). • This humidifier is not to be used by persons (including children) with reduced physical, sensory, or mental capabilities, or lack of experience and knowledge, unless they have been given supervision or instruction concerning use of the appliance by a person responsible for their safety. • Supervise children when they are near the humidifier. • Children should not clean or perform maintenance on the humidifier without supervision. • Children should be supervised to ensure that they do not play with the humidifier. • Not for commercial use. Household use only. READ AND SAVE THESE INSTRUCTIONS 4 Power & Cord Electromagnetic Fields (EMF) • Ensure that the plug fits properly into a polarized socket. • Your humidifier has a polarized plug (one prong is wider than the other), which fits into a polarized outlet only one way. This is a safety feature to reduce the risk of electric shock. If the plug does not fit, reverse the plug. If it still does not fit, do not use the plug in that outlet. Do not bypass this safety feature. • Do not handle the power cord or plug with wet hands. Keep the plug and power cord away from liquids. • If the power supply cord is damaged, it must be replaced by Arovast Corporation or similarly qualified persons in order to avoid an electric or fire hazard. Please contact Customer Support (see page 27). • Unplugging the power cord will disable remote control of the humidifier and temporarily disconnect the humidifier from VeSync and other third-party apps. This product contains a coin/button battery. WARNING: CHEMICAL BURN HAZARD. KEEP OUT OF REACH OF CHILDREN. 5 These sorts of symptoms vary or fluctuate, with the pain increasing and then subsiding. A specific symptom to button and coin battery ingestion is vomiting fresh (bright red) blood. If a child does this, seek immediate medical help. The lack of clear symptoms is why it is important to be cautious with “flat” or spare button or coin batteries in the home and the products that contain them. Even used cells may cause injury. Unfortunately, it is not obvious when a button or coin battery is stuck in a child’s esophagus (food pipe). The child might: SAFETY INFORMATION (CONT.) • Cough, gag or drool a lot; • Appear to have a stomach upset or a virus; • Be sick; • Point to their throat or stomach; • Have pain in their abdomen, chest, or throat; • Be tired or lethargic; • Be quieter or more clingy than usual…

Applicable Standards Systems operating under the provisions of this section shall be operated in a manner that ensures that the public is not exposed to radio frequency energy level in excess limit for maximum permissible exposure. In accordance with 47 CFR FCC Part 2 Subpart J, section 2.1091 this device has been defined as a mobile device whereby a distance of 0.2m normally can be maintained between the user and the device. 1.1. Limits for Maximum Permissible Exposure (MPE) (a) Limits for Occupational/Controlled Exposure Frequency Range (MHz) Electric Field Strength (E) (V/m) Magnetic Field Strength (H) (A/m) Power Density (S) (mW/cm 2 ) Averaging Times ︱E︱ 2 ,︱H︱ 2 or S (minutes) 0.3-3.0 614 1.63 (100)* 6 3.0-30 1842/f 4.89/f (900/f)* 6 30-300 61.4 0.163 1.0 6 300-1500 F/300 6 1500-10000 5 6 (b) Limits for General Population / Uncontrolled Exposure Frequency Range (MHz) Electric Field Strength (E) (V/m) Magnetic Field Strength (H) (A/m) Power Density (S) (mW/cm 2 ) Averaging Times ︱E︱ 2 ,︱H︱ 2 or S (minutes) 0.3-1.34 614 1.63 (100)* 30 1.34-30 824/f 2.19/f (180/f)* 30 30-300 27.5 0.073 0.2 30 300-1500 F/1500 30 1500-10000 1.o 30 Note: f=frequency in MHz; *Plane-wave equivalent power density FCC ID: 2ARBY-M101S EST Technology Co. ,Ltd Report No. ESTE-R2209164 Page 3 of 5 1.2. MPE Calculation Method E (V/m) = d G × P × 30 Power Density: Pd (W/m 2 ) = 377 E 2 E = Electric Field (V/m) P = Peak RF output Power (W) G = EUT Antenna numeric gain (numeric) d = Separation distance between radiator and human body (m) The formula can be changed to Pd = 2 d × 377 G × P × 30 From the peak EUT RF output power, the minimum mobile separation distance, d=0.2m, as well as the gain of the used antenna, the RF power density can be obtained FCC ID: 2ARBY-M101S EST Technology Co. ,Ltd Report No. ESTE-R2209164 Page 4 of 5 2.
